Title :
Score functions for locally subptimum and locally suboptimum rank detection in alpha-stable interference

Abstract :
Approximations to the locally optimum and locally optimum rank score functions for the detection of a known signal in additive symmetric α stable interference have been shown to introduce only slight performance loss. Here, the location of the apices of the nonlinearities is shown to follow an approximate linear relationship with the characteristic exponent, α, of the interference. The distribution of the corresponding test statistics is also found to be approximately Gaussian. These findings make implementation of the detectors more feasible and remove some expensive computational burden
